Serving the Homeless and Needy

Agape Outreach Inc is a charity organisation making a difference in the lives of hurting, broken and disenfranchised people. Founded on January 26th, 2009, Agape began when Theresa Mitchell found she could no longer walk past people on the street, so began handing out a small number of meals in her local area, cooked in her very own kitchen.

Agape, now based on Recreation Street in Tweed Heads, has more than 200 volunteers and 4 employees. Agape is volunteer-based and is made up of mostly retirees and university interns with a heart of people. We operate between Byron Bay on the North Coast of New South Wales and Runaway Bay on the Gold Coast in Queensland, providing over 800 hot meals every week to vulnerable people on the streets and a range of different services. Agape (from Ancient Greek agápē) means ‘unconditional love’ and embraces a deep and profound sacrificial love that transcends and persists, regardless of circumstance. It is what we desire to pass on to others every day.

We are not affiliated with a church, rather Agape is run with Theresa’s heart for Jesus and nothing more. No church services, no praying over meals, no preaching, just love and action. Volunteers and clients are welcome from all walks of life and beliefs, so please come and join us.
